SIGNING IN: BEING SHOWERED BY HEAVENLY BLESSINGS FOR FIVE YEARS Chapter 60

Driving the navy-blue Dentley out of the Lotus Palace complex, Diamond was having a headache. A very strong one that would require bottles of pills before it was healed.

[My lady, you don't look okay. How about I take over while you rest?] Andrea suddenly suggested upon seeing Diamond's complexion.

Diamond glared at the cat on the screen and inwardly chided the other, 'If it weren't for you, would I be in this situation that I am in right now?'

Just thinking about how Andrea had roasted her about her poor social skills and how she should start reading books and getting lessons. Diamond felt like fainting throughout the conversation.

However, as much angry as she was about that, she also understood that Andrea was doing everything for her benefit. And that she shouldn't hate him. After all, where else would she get someone willing to be brutally honest with her?

"Fine, take over. I will sort out my thoughts on the way."

Since there was no need to fuss over things and make things difficult for herself whilst there was an A. I who was willing to do the job for her.

[Automatic control initiated!]

Diamond watched for the first time as Andrea took over the wheel. Although she knew about self-driving cars, that was her first time being a passenger in one, despite her car having the same function.

The drive to the hotel where Kian was staying would take an hour or so. Instead of letting him come and pick her up, Diamond wanted to take the initiative to bring the other.

At the same time, she didn't want Kian to know where she was staying in the meantime. It was still too early, and she wanted to study the man, if anything was ever going to happen in the future.

If it was going to be a fling, then there was no need for the other to know her place. Hotels were the best places to go, after all.

Instead of just relaxing and enjoying the cool ride with Andrea, Diamond was checking herself through the mirror.

For that epic date, she had really outdone herself. Apart from when she attended the birthday banquet with Cecilia, she had never dressed like that again.

At the same time, at **** hotel, Kian was standing in front of his brother, who was adjusting his blazer neatly and making sure that everything was in order before he left.

"Aren't you done yet?" Kian asked Sullivan teasingly, who had been at that for some time now.

Sullivan flashed a smile at Kian as he responded, "We need to make sure that you look amazing and wow everyone. Impressions should be good. Otherwise, how are you going to bring the lady home?"

Hearing such a comment; Kian knew that Sullivan was up to no good, but he loved it anyway.

Patting Sullivan's shoulder with his right hand, Kian said to him with a reassuring tone, "Don't worry, bro. I have never been serious about other things in life, but this time, I will make sure that I win her over. No matter how long it takes."

Sullivan removed his hands from the blazer lapels and stared Kian in the eyes.

After sorting out his feelings regarding his brother's crush, Sullivan no longer hides it. It was useless and since just like Kian; it was his first time to have such strong feelings towards a girl he never met in person. He wanted to give a good impression.

And since the two of them shared the same face. The better Diamond looks upon Kian, the better it is for him, too.

And as the two were busy looking at each other, and silently communicating as they always did from a young age, Kian's phone started ringing.

Hearing the unique ringtone Kian specifically set for her, a smile appeared on his face.

Sullivan watched as his serious brother suddenly turned into a love-struck fool and his heart was filled with so much jealousy.

'How I wished I was the first that met her? It would have been me, I guess.'

But there were no ifs in life. Maybe it was destined to be. And he would just wait and see where that would take them.

Nevertheless, he sincerely hoped and prayed that Diamond would take a liking to Kian, for only then could he also make a move at her. And also hope that she won't kick them out of her life for even thinking about sharing her.

Not everyone was truly comfortable with that topic. Most people, especially, found it degrading and insulting. He didn't want her to look at them as if they were perverts.

"My lady!" like a proper gentleman, Kian, who wasn't seeing Diamond, called out his favorite endearment the second he picked.

Sullivan watched as Kian kept a smile on his face as he talked to the woman, he wished he could talk to and have a face-to-face and get to know each other.

After talking on the phone for less than a minute, Kian turned to face Sullivan and said, "She is here. I will go down. You better take care of yourself and keep Charlie in place."

Sullivan nodded his head in agreement, though his heart ached fully knowing how much enjoyment Kian would be experiencing that night.

"Go and have fun. And don't let anyone take advantage of her!" Sullivan reminded as he recalled some bad stuff Kian told him about regarding Diamond's days at school.

Looking at Sullivan, Kian's smile suddenly turned creepy and sly as a glint of ruthlessness appeared in his eyes.

"Don't worry. Heh, when have I ever been a pushover?" Kian chuckled.

Seeing that side of his brother again, Sullivan finally was at ease. "Umm, that's good then," he said as he patted his shoulder. "You better go now. It's rude to keep a lady waiting."

Kian glanced at his brother one last time, before leaving the room with swift steps and without turning back.
